Laura Eigbrecht, Academic Assistant at DHBW Karlsruhe, and Prof. Dr. Ulf-Daniel Ehlers, Professor of Educational Management and Lifelong Learning at DHBW, are delighted to announce the publication of the book "Creating the University of the Future - A Global View on Future Skills and Future Higher Education", following intensive collaboration with international experts such as Andreas Schleicher, Tom Wambeke and Angela Duckworth and the exploration of innovative educational practices from all six continents.

"Creating the University of the Future - A Global View on Future Skills and Future Higher Education" contains 30 contributions that offer insights into the future of higher education and skills development.

To mark the publication, the editors invite you to a digital launch event on June 25 from 15:00 to 16:30 (CEST). The event offers the opportunity to get to know the publication and some of the contributors. In a Future Skills panel, Francesc Pedró, Emma Harden-Wolfson, Eglis Chacón and Tom Wambeke will give insights into their chapters and discuss current challenges and developments in the field of Future Skills. This will be followed by a convivial Future Skills Apéro.The digital launch event will be held in English.

The book "Creating the University of the Future" is now available as an open access publication via the following link: https://link.springer.com/book/10.1007/978-3-658-42948-5.
